Output 3e281630c9e01c54dcf797734ebb4e14a8950b6e52cb4b802c63f99b82d2e40d:1

value
16434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 692b062091646cadbe204990290f2c6e87b383c8 OP_EQUAL
address
3BH6R3MFirjwqxWzAvaMwg5XNTTmRZbVWj
transaction
3e281630c9e01c54dcf797734ebb4e14a8950b6e52cb4b802c63f99b82d2e40d
confirmations
365078
spent
true